Invoice: Meta_Dates

What this view is for Invoice.meta_dates provides the key billing, lifecycle and payment-related dates for invoices. If: then meta_dates explains when important invoice events occurred or are expected to occur. This view is central to billing timelines, ageing analysis and cashflow reporting. Invoice: Meta_Codes

What this view is for Invoice.meta_codes provides the classification, status and commercial context for invoices. If: then meta_codes explains how the invoice should be interpreted, including its status, type, numbering context, payment terms and links back to upstream objects. Customer.InvoiceValue

Purpose The Customer Invoice Value view provides detailed financial information on customer invoices, including gross, VAT, and net amounts across multiple currencies. This view is focused on delivering a comprehensive breakdown of financial values, allowing for detailed reporting and analysis of invoice data. Customer.InvoiceStatus

Purpose The Customer Invoice Status view provides insight into the operational state of customer invoices by tracking statuses and reporting errors. This view is intended for monitoring the life-cycle and status changes of invoices, including entry dates, user actions, and error messages.
